  • Penfolds Grange & others (Extra Space): Tasted blind. Pop and poured.
    Appearance is clear, medium intensity, purplish ruby colour. Legs.
    Nose is clean, medium intensity, with aromas of saline minerality and sour red cherries. Youthful.
    On the palate, dry, high acidity, medium alcohol, soft medium+ tannins, medium+ body. Medium flavour intensity, with flavours of sour red cherries, red plums, and some saline minerality. Medium+ finish.
    Good quality. Soft easy drinking food wine. Drink now, unlikely to improve much further with age. Clearly Sangiovese dominant with Merlot softening the blend.
    80% Sangiovese, with 20% Merlot, Syrah and Petit Verdot, aged for 2 years in steel tanks, but with a light passage in wood.
